How We Review Trucking Insurance Companies

Our editorial process is independent, transparent, and updated annually. Here's exactly how we score every carrier.

Our Rating Criteria

Each carrier is scored on a 5-point scale across five equally weighted categories:

CategoryWeightWhat We Evaluate
Coverage Options25%Range of policy types, customization, limits available
Claims Handling25%Speed, communication, dispute resolution, owner-operator reviews
Financial Stability20%AM Best rating, years in business, capital reserves
Pricing & Transparency20%Competitiveness, online quoting, hidden fees
Customer Service10%Availability, responsiveness, digital tools

Our Research Process

  1. Carrier identification: We identify all major commercial trucking insurance carriers operating in the US.
  2. Data collection: We collect AM Best ratings, coverage details, and publicly available pricing data.
  3. Owner-operator interviews: We survey active owner-operators and fleet managers about their claims experiences.
  4. Mystery shopping: Our team obtains actual quotes for standard trucking profiles to compare pricing.
  5. Annual review: All ratings are reviewed and updated at least once per year.

Data Sources

  • AM Best financial strength ratings
  • FMCSA SAFER system (carrier safety data)
  • State DOT filing databases
  • NAIC complaint ratio data
  • Owner-operator community surveys (Truckers Forum, OOIDA members)
